Madhya Pradesh High Court Grants 6 Weeks for Union Carbide Waste Disposal
The Madhya Pradesh High Court has given the state government six weeks to ensure proper disposal of Union Carbide factory waste in accordance with safety guidelines. This follows the shift of waste, sealed in 12 containers, from the defunct factory in Bhopal to a disposal site in Pithampur, about 250 km away, on January 2, 2025. TTD Receives Rs. 1,365 Crore in Donations in 2024, 2.55 Crore Devotees Visit Tirumala
Tirumala Tirupati Devasthanams (TTD) has reported an impressive Rs. 1,365 crore in Hundi donations for the year 2024. The temple saw a significant number of pilgrims, with 2.55 crore devotees visiting the holy site. A remarkable 99 lakh devotees participated in the tradition of tonsuring their heads as an offering to Lord Venkateswara. K Vijayanand to Take Charge as Andhra Pradesh's New Chief Secretary
Andhra Pradesh is set to welcome its new Chief Secretary, K Vijayanand, who will assume the role on December 31. Vijayanand, an IAS officer from the 1992 batch, will replace Neerabh Kumar Prasad, who is retiring after reaching the age of superannuation. Neerabh Kumar Prasad had been serving as Chief Secretary since shortly after the Andhra Pradesh elections in June 2024. His retirement has led to the swift appointment of K Vijayanand, a highly respected and experienced IAS officer.
